
En un panorama de desarrollo de software cada vez más rápido, entregar código de alta calidad, mantenible y eficiente es crucial. Extreme Programming (XP) ofrece un enfoque estructurado para lograrlo, integrando Test-Driven Development (TDD), Integración y Despliegue Continuos (CI/CD), Pair Programming, Refactoring y prácticas ágiles.
Este curso está diseñado para ayudar a desarrolladores, ingenieros y practicantes ágiles a adoptar técnicas XP para construir software robusto y optimizar flujos de desarrollo. Es práctico y orientado a la implementación real, con ejemplos y ejercicios que puedes aplicar de inmediato.
Ya seas desarrollador individual o trabajes en equipo, estas prácticas mejorarán tu excelencia en ingeniería y te prepararán para colaborar eficazmente en equipos Agile.
Lo que aprenderás:
- Integrar prácticas XP en flujos de desarrollo Agile para ganar eficiencia
- El papel del TDD para reducir defectos y mejorar mantenibilidad
- Buenas prácticas para programación en pareja y maximizar la colaboración
- Configurar y gestionar una tubería de CI para pruebas automatizadas
- Impacto de CD en ciclos de entrega y velocidad de despliegue
- Técnicas para identificar y eliminar code smells mediante refactoring
- Diseñar software simple, flexible y escalable con los principios de XP
- Propiedad de código colectiva y cómo implementarla
- Aplicar desarrollo incremental para liberar software funcional más rápido
- La psicología de la colaboración efectiva y feedback en XP
- Planificación adaptativa y respuesta rápida a cambios
- Medir el éxito con métricas ágiles y de XP
- Manejo proactivo de deuda técnica para evitar costos a largo plazo
- Casos de estudio XP en empresas reales
Contenido del curso:
- Secciones: 7
- Clases: 30
- Duración: 8h 32m
Requisitos:
- Conocimientos básicos de principios de desarrollo de software; no se requiere experiencia profunda
- Experiencia trabajando en equipo
- Algo de exposición a metodologías Ágiles (Scrum, Kanban o Lean) es útil
- Interés en escribir código más limpio y mantenible
- Disposición para aprender de forma continua; XP se basa en retroalimentación frecuente
- No se requiere experiencia previa con Extreme Programming
¿Para quién es este curso?
- Desarrolladores e Ingenieros de Nivel Medio a Senior
- Ingenieros de software enfocados en la calidad del código
- Coaches Ágiles y Líderes de Ingeniería
- Desarrolladores que realizan la transición a entornos Agile
- Ingenieros de DevOps y CI/CD
- Ingenieros de QA y testers de automatización
- Arquitectos de software y Tech Leads
- Startups y Equipos de Producto
- Equipos de desarrollo que buscan mejorar la colaboración
- Personas interesadas en prácticas XP para mejorar la entrega de software
¿Qué esperas para comenzar?
Inscríbete hoy mismo y lleva tus habilidades al siguiente nivel. ¡Los cupones son limitados y pueden agotarse en cualquier momento!
👉 Aprovecha el cupón ahora – Cupón SEPTEMBER_FREE2_2025
Deja un comentario
Cursos relacionados: